After graduation, Musical Theater BFA alumni have appeared in productions on Broadway, on national tours, and at major theaters in and around Philadelphia including the Arden Theater Company, Paper Mill Playhouse and Walnut Street Theatre. The Center for the Performing and Cinematic Arts, comprised of constituent faculty and programs within the Department of Theater in collaboration with sister faculty and programs in the Boyer College of Music and Dance, is ideally suited to offer such a progressive degree opportunity. The Temple Department of Theater boasts a half century of excellence in theater training, and BFA candidates also benefit from interdisciplinary training in the Boyer College of Music and Dance, as both are housed in the Center for the Performing and Cinematic Arts. View the current Temple University tuition rates and utilize the tuition calculator to estimate your tuition rate by selecting your specific student characteristics, such as school or college, student level, residency, etc. The Bachelor of Fine Arts in Musical Theater at Temple is focused on building well-rounded, versatile "triple-threat" artists who have developed the prerequisite skills and tools necessary for a life as a theater professional.
